Army collects 38 high-powered firearms in Maguindanao del Sur 

- Advertisement -

Local government officials from several areas in Maguindanao del Sur surrendered 38 assorted firearms to the 33rd Infantry Battalion (33IB) at their headquarters in Brgy Zapakan, Radjah Buayan.

Hailing from Shariff Aguak, Datu Abdullah Sangki, Sultan sa Barongis, Mamasapano, and Radjah Buayan, the weapons were turned in as part of the “Balik-Baril Program,” aimed at reducing loose firearms in the region. 

These include three 60mm mortars, one 40mm M79 grenade launcher, four RPGs, three M203 grenade launchers, one 5.56mm M4 carbine, four 9mm submachine guns, five .38-caliber pistols, four .45-caliber 1911 pistols, three 9mm KG9 submachine guns, five 9mm Uzis, two 9mm Engram submachine guns, one .45-caliber Engram submachine gun, and two shotguns.

The firearms were officially presented to Brig. Gen. Oriel Pangcog, Commanding Officer of the 601st Infantry Brigade, alongside local officials including Mayor Samsudin Sangki and various barangay chairpersons.

Lt. Gen. William Gonzales, commander of WestMinCom, emphasized the importance of continuing efforts to combat the proliferation of loose firearms and uphold peace in the Bangsamoro region.
